Program Overview

Master of Logistics Management (Thesis) (Turkish), Istanbul Okan University

The Master of Logistics Management (Thesis) program is focused on equipping students with advanced knowledge and research skills in logistics and supply chain management. This program emphasizes the importance of research and analytical thinking in developing innovative solutions to complex logistics challenges. Its significance is underscored by the increasing complexities of global supply chains, making it essential for graduates to be well-versed in both theoretical and practical aspects of logistics management.

Curriculum

Research Methods in Logistics
Advanced Supply Chain Management
Transportation Logistics
Warehouse Operations
Thesis Research Project
